NWSL Kansas City Current March 18, 2024 - KANSAS CITY - The Kansas City Current, along with the National Women's Soccer League and Angel City FC, have announced a new start time for the team's match March 30. Originally scheduled for a 1:30 p.m. start time, the match will now begin at 2:30 p.m. CT. The match will be carried live on ESPN and ESPN+. NWSL Chicago Red Stars March 18, 2024 - CHICAGO - Chicago Red Stars president, Karen Leetzow, appointed Kay Bradley as the club's new Chief Marketing Officer, the club announced today. Bradley joins the Red Stars from U.S. Soccer where she served as vice president of marketing and led integrated marketing, fan engagement and loyalty, content, brand development and creative. March 18, 2024 - The North Carolina Courage won its opening game of the 2024 National Women's Soccer League season with a 5-1 victory over the Houston Dash in front of 5,878 fans, a club record for home openers, at WakeMed Soccer Park on Saturday evening. The Courage had possession of the ball 58 percent of the time. Newcomer Bianca St-Georges became the first player in the NWSL with a brace in her team debut since 2014.
